DIFFERENT TYPES OF CONCRETE ADMIXTURES AND THEIR EFFECT ON PROPERTIES OF FRESH AND HARD SPRAYED CONCRETE
Hela, Vlastimil ; Brožovský, Jiří (advisor)
The current technology for sprayed concrete cannot do without various types of concrete admixtures allowing that more demanding requirements for quality and overall characteristics of Sprayed Concrete can be met. These are mainly concrete plastificators and set acceleration admixtures. In practice these technologies are employed especially in construction of underground structures where the working conditions are often very restricted. In these days Sprayed Concrete is usually applied by wet spraying where the fresh concrete is made in a batching plant and then transported to the construction site. That is why it is also important to pay attention to rheology characteristics of sprayed concrete. The concrete is then placed by a special spraying plant while it is ensured that all requirements and technical specifications for sprayed concrete are complied with. The characteristics are most affected by the admixtures - both plastificators and accelerators and their compatibility with cement. In order to acquire new evidence in the field of sprayed concrete technology and use of admixtures and their effect in relation with various types of cement a number of combinations of admixtures and cements were tested. Gradually results were obtained and recorded for rheology of cement mortars and concrete, for characteristics of young sprayed concrete mixes and for the comparison between the laboratory tests and findings from daily practice.

Proposition of conception of using micro-additions for High Performance Concrete
Lédl, Matěj ; Hela, Vlastimil (referee) ; Hela, Rudolf (advisor)
The modern, contemporarily used cement composite types make use of various additives. This diploma thesis is focused on designs of mortars that have been enriched with micro and nano additives, which lead to higher mechanical strength through optimized grading of mortar mixes. This thesis also evaluates the influence of material properties on resulting properties of mortars in fresh and hardened state.
